CBIRS Request 3045
 
Community Budget Issue Requests - Tracking Id #3045
West Florida Emergency Food Bank
 
Requester: David Reaney Organization: Bay Area Food Bank
 
Project Title: West Florida Emergency Food Bank Date Submitted 1/13/2006 1:12:37 PM
 
Sponsors: Peaden
 
Statewide Interest:
Consistent with state goals of serving needy popoulation as well as disaaster relief and recovery.

Counties: Escambia, Okaloosa, Santa Rosa, Walton
 
Gov't Entity:   Private Organization (Profit/Not for Profit): Yes
 
Project Description:
Construction of a food warehouse and distribution facility to serve day-to-day hunger needs of poor citizens and community needs in disaster.
 
Is this a project related to a federal or state declared disaster? Yes
If yes, which declared disaster? Hurricane Ivan and Dennis highlighted needs.
If yes, which year? 2004,2005
 
Measurable Outcome Anticipated:
ABility to distribute 5 million pounds of donated food annually.
 
Amount requested from the State for this project this year: $700,000
 
Total cost of the project: $1,200,000
 
Request has been made to fund: Construction
 
What type of match exists for this project? Private
  Cash Amount $500,000  
 
Was this project previously funded by the state?   No
 
Is future-year funding likely to be requested?   No
 
Was this project included in an Agency's Budget Request?   No
 
Was this project included in the Governor's Recommended Budget? No
 
Is there a documented need for this project? Yes
  Documentation: Agency Needs Assessment
 
Was this project request heard before a publicly noticed meeting of a body of elected officials (municipal, county, or state)?   Yes
  Hearing Body: Escambia County Commission
  Hearing Meeting Date: 11/17/2005
 
Is this a water project as described in Section 403.885, Laws of Florida?   No
